Sheet pan dinner recipes are a busy parent’s best friend. Aside from ordering in or heating up a frozen meal (and we’re not knocking those pinch-hitting strategies!), it’s the easiest way to get dinner on the table, fast. Just chop up a protein and some veggies (which you can do in advance..), add seasoning or a glaze, and roast in the oven. Here are the basic steps you’ll need.
1. Choose Your Veggies
Pick fast-cooking choices if you want dinner ready ASAP. These include zucchini, onion, broccoli or green beans. If you go for root veggies like potatoes or carrots, add another 5 to 10 minutes of cooking time in before you add your protein.
2. Choose Your Protein
Salmon, chicken or tofu—whether you want to serve fish, meat or a vegetarian dish, there are endless options!
3. Add Seasoning
Go-to combos for Anne Mauney, the R.D. behind Fannetastic Food, include Lemon Dijon and Ginger Soy Glaze. But something as easy as olive oil and salt and pepper works well, too!
